1991Oversized driver
Innovator: Callaway
It didn't have a dimpled head like TaylorMade's earliest effort, but the first thin-walled, oversized steel driver, named for a German cannon in World War I, was supremely easy to hit thanks to its huge sweet spot. The original Bertha was one of the most influential clubs of the last century and putt Callaway on the golf equipment map.
